Compliance Standards and Environmental Verification

In the realm of eco-friendly procurement, verifying compliance is as critical as assessing physical dimensions. The provided data explicitly lists "CE" as a product standard, which is a mandatory conformity marking for products sold within the European Economic Area. This indicates that the plastic snap buttons meet specific health, safety, and environmental protection requirements. However, the term "eco-friendly" often invites further scrutiny beyond basic CE marking.

The data mentions "Reach" and "OEKO-TEX" in the low-confidence background section. While these are not confirmed as active certifications for every listed item, they represent industry benchmarks for chemical safety and textile safety, respectively. "Reach" (Registration, Evaluation, Authorisation and Restriction of Chemicals) is a European Union regulation aimed at protecting human health and the environment from the risks posed by chemicals. For a product marketed as eco-friendly, verifying compliance with Reach regulations regarding restricted substances like phthalates, heavy metals, and azo dyes is essential. Similarly, "OEKO-TEX" certification ensures that the product is free from harmful substances that could be detrimental to human health, a crucial factor for items in direct contact with skin, such as shirts, jeans, and coats.

Buyers should not assume that "eco-friendly" claims are universally validated by the listed standards. The data notes "Sustainable/Washable/Durable/Eco-Friendly" as product features, but these are observations rather than guaranteed certifications. To substantiate these claims, procurement teams must request specific test reports from suppliers. These reports should confirm the absence of hazardous substances and validate the durability claims that contribute to the product's lifecycle sustainability. A durable product reduces waste by lasting longer, which is a core tenet of eco-friendly design.

Furthermore, the "Plating" technics listed for metal variants and "Molded Injection" for plastic variants suggest different environmental footprints. Buyers should inquire about the recycling content of the plastic used. While the data confirms the material is plastic, it does not specify if it is virgin or recycled. True eco-friendly sourcing often involves prioritizing suppliers who utilize post-consumer recycled (PCR) materials. The "Feature" attribute of "Anti-corrosion" is also relevant, as corrosion resistance extends the product's life, reducing the frequency of replacement and associated waste.

Cost Drivers and Pricing Dynamics

The pricing structure for plastic snap buttons is influenced by several interconnected factors, including material costs, customization levels, and order volume. The observed price range in the market is listed as 0-100 USD, which likely represents a broad spectrum covering everything from single-unit samples to bulk industrial orders. This wide range underscores the importance of understanding the cost drivers specific to the buyer's requirements.

One of the primary cost drivers is the level of customization. The data confirms that "Customization" is available, with options for "Logo: as Your Request" and "Accept Customized Logo." Custom molds, unique color matching, and specific decorative elements like "Stripes" or "Unique" designs incur additional tooling and setup costs. While standard "Round" or "Simple" style buttons may be produced at a lower unit cost, bespoke designs will naturally command a higher price. The "Color Matching" attribute further implies that custom color formulation can impact the final cost, especially for small to medium-sized orders.

Order volume, or the Minimum Order Quantity (MOQ), plays a significant role in unit pricing. The observed MOQ range spans from 1 to 10,000 units. For buyers seeking to minimize inventory risk, the ability to order as few as one unit is advantageous, though the unit price will be higher. Conversely, larger orders, such as the "50000sets/Carton" packing detail mentioned, typically benefit from economies of scale, resulting in a lower cost per unit. The "Packing Detail" also varies, with options like "1gross/Bag," "5gross/Bag," or "10gross/Bag" for demand-based packaging. Customized packing solutions, while convenient for logistics, may add to the overall cost if they require specialized handling or labeling.

Material costs are another variable. While the primary material is plastic, the specific type of resin or polymer used can affect the price. The "Resin Button" variant with stripes suggests a potentially higher-grade or more complex material formulation compared to standard molded injection plastic. Additionally, the "Feature" of being "Eco-Friendly" may involve a premium if the supplier uses recycled or bio-based plastics, which can be more expensive to source and process than conventional virgin plastics.

Lead times and shipping methods also influence the total cost of ownership. The data lists shipment options including "by Air," "by Ship," and "by Train." Air freight offers speed but at a significantly higher cost, suitable for urgent sample runs or small orders. Sea freight is more cost-effective for large volumes but involves longer lead times. The "Sample: Free" attribute is a positive indicator for initial evaluation, reducing the upfront financial barrier for buyers. However, buyers must clarify if the free sample includes shipping costs, as this can vary by supplier and destination.
